“King born or made?” That was the question that sounded before the beginning of the 20th century. This means that perhaps a person with a leadership potential is born outside the royal palace, or a “can” leader is formed with the royal court’s education.
Two World Wars made European societies no longer trust the king’s decision, they were willingly converted to constitutional state, meaning the figure of the king only as a symbol of unifying is holding the government is the Prime Minister, a concept which is then imitated by various countries, for example, modern Japan. But it is unique after the power of the King and Queen is “reduced” but the Monarchy system continues to last until now.
“Raja adil disembah, raja lalim disanggah” means “The righteous king is worshiped, the unjust king is refuted” The concept in almost all kingdoms in Indonesia before touching the Imperialist-Colonialists. This means that the Sultan of the archipelago was required to prosper the people, although there are times when the situation is still turbulent, this can be proved by the survival of customs system throughout Indonesia. Feudalism as a system gives birth to despotism, sometimes even spur the social revolution.
The current kingdom or sultanate system no longer prevails, it is proved that no kingdom has been established since the beginning of the 20th century. With the exception of a long-standing empire, virtually no new kingdom is formed.
The system of Republican government based on Democracy is considered the ideal form of government throughout the world today, the slogan “Vox Populi, Vox Dei” seems to be heard everywhere. “The voice of the people, the voice of God” is the meaning of the question, but what is the question of the people’s voice that reflects the voice of the god?
